opendevreview | OpenStack Proposal Bot proposed openstack/project-config master: Normalize projects.yaml https://review.opendev.org/c/openstack/project-config/+/957995 | 02:08 |
---|---|---|
*** mrunge_ is now known as mrunge | 05:55 | |
opendevreview | Dmitriy Rabotyagov proposed openstack/diskimage-builder master: Add Fedora 41 and 42 tests https://review.opendev.org/c/openstack/diskimage-builder/+/958519 | 08:01 |
opendevreview | Dmitriy Rabotyagov proposed openstack/diskimage-builder master: Remove unsupported Fedora releases from CI https://review.opendev.org/c/openstack/diskimage-builder/+/958520 | 08:04 |
opendevreview | Dmitriy Rabotyagov proposed openstack/diskimage-builder master: Add support for DNF5-based systems https://review.opendev.org/c/openstack/diskimage-builder/+/934332 | 09:49 |
opendevreview | Dmitriy Rabotyagov proposed openstack/diskimage-builder master: Add support for DNF5-based systems https://review.opendev.org/c/openstack/diskimage-builder/+/934332 | 09:49 |
opendevreview | Dmitriy Rabotyagov proposed openstack/diskimage-builder master: Add Fedora 41 and 42 tests https://review.opendev.org/c/openstack/diskimage-builder/+/958519 | 09:49 |
opendevreview | Dmitriy Rabotyagov proposed openstack/diskimage-builder master: Add support for DNF5-based systems https://review.opendev.org/c/openstack/diskimage-builder/+/934332 | 09:51 |
profcorey | fungi: Revisiting that wiki error to edit and update https://wiki.openstack.org/wiki/Cascade, I still don't have permissions to do so. I login with my nickname, but receive "OpenID error, An error occurred: an invalid token was found. Any suggestions to cure this. | 13:29 |
profcorey | fungi: I also receive a 404 error for the docs URL https://docs.openstack.org/cascade/latest | 13:30 |
profcorey | fungi: last issue, also missing a launchpad page for Cascade as well, https://bugs.launchpad.net/cascade | 13:32 |
fungi | profcorey: sadly, i don't know what to do about the wiki login problem, it's been an infrequent issue for years, hopefully once we get onto newer mediawiki/openid plugin and/or switch to our own keycloak as an sso it will get better. i was able to reproduce the issue at one time with a test account, but after some undetermined period the account started being able to log in. i see | 13:43 |
fungi | one report of the same error message from a fedora community wiki 8 years ago, so i guess it's not just us, but no indication of how or if it was fixed there either: https://lists.fedorahosted.org/archives/list/freeipa-users@lists.fedorahosted.org/thread/UOJBRX3BRYFE7E3OG5NXR773PAZLHOBN/ | 13:43 |
fungi | i've resarted the wiki server since we do sometimes see stuck user sessions after the server gets blasted hard by ai/llm training crawlers and clearing them seems to help, so maybe try logging in one more time now, but my suspicion with the error you're seeing is that launchpad/ubuntu one sso sometimes generates openid tokens which our mediawiki's openid plugin version can't parse | 13:43 |
fungi | for some reason | 13:43 |
fungi | load on the server is really high at the moment, looks like we probably need to identify and block some more recent bots | 13:43 |
profcorey | thank you for the explanation fungi | 13:44 |
profcorey | I'm not in a time crunch for this, but eventually I plan to propose this project to the TC for converting to an official OpenStack project. I'm planning for the next NA OpenInfra Day meeting. | 13:45 |
profcorey | And I am trying to recruit contributors so having all of these tools would help | 13:46 |
fungi | profcorey: as for docs publication, i'm not sure what the openstack technical committee's stance is on non-openstack projects being on docs.openstack.org, though we do have a docs.opendev.org for more general documentation publication outside openstack, or some projects have jobs call a publication webhook on readthedocs.org | 13:46 |
profcorey | But, I appreciate your time with this | 13:46 |
fungi | and we don't auto-create launchpad project entries, that's something you'd do manually if you wanted to use it | 13:47 |
profcorey | I'll take the non-openstack docs to start generating documentation | 13:47 |
profcorey | Ok, thank you for letting me know about launchpad. I'll take care of this. | 13:47 |
fungi | also i'm on vacation until 2025-09-04 but other folks should also be around in this channel later in the day | 13:49 |
profcorey | Oh I'm sorry I didn't know you were on PTO. Let's push this for September then. | 13:50 |
fungi | no worries, i was checking in on other things and didn't want to leave you hanging | 13:50 |
profcorey | I won't bug you anymore | 13:50 |
profcorey | Thank you! | 13:50 |
fungi | not a problem, really ;) | 13:51 |
fungi | you're welcome | 13:51 |
clarkb | I did some quick testing of the held etherpad 2.5.0 node. The landing page's css still seems a bit off but isn't as bad as before (not sure we'd consider it good enough to update to). The error when a second (third etc) client joins a pad seems to have been fixed which is good. That was the bigger of the two problems | 15:42 |
clarkb | if anyone else wants to test the held node's IP is in the meeting agenda and I have a test pad called clarkb-test you can check | 15:42 |
jrosser | i have a job running on what i hope is a debain trixie node, but /etc/os-release references forky https://zuul.opendev.org/t/openstack/build/74509f9cb0f14eb5b0f15f7d215043e0/log/job-output.txt#4278-4281 | 17:17 |
clarkb | jrosser: I think that must mean no one updated the image builds to build the new release after the release was done | 17:18 |
jrosser | oh and the apt repo its using also is forky | 17:18 |
clarkb | ya because its not trixie its testing | 17:21 |
jrosser | ah here we go https://opendev.org/opendev/zuul-providers/src/branch/master/zuul.d/image-build-jobs.yaml#L386-L392 | 17:21 |
clarkb | before the trixie release they were basically the same due to the freeze | 17:21 |
clarkb | I'm working on a change to ^ to fix it | 17:21 |
opendevreview | Clark Boylan proposed opendev/zuul-providers master: Build actual trixie now that it is released https://review.opendev.org/c/opendev/zuul-providers/+/958561 | 17:22 |
clarkb | there | 17:22 |
jrosser | great, thanks | 17:22 |
clarkb | frickler: ^ maybe you want to review that one? | 17:22 |
clarkb | I think that should be self testing and once merged should udpate images directly rather than waiting for periodic jobs? Not 100% certain of that though | 17:25 |
clarkb | since I'm only changing the job definition it may not trigger the publication jobs? | 17:25 |
corvus | clarkb: there are TODO lines around the line you changed | 17:25 |
clarkb | corvus: oh yup the first todo should be dropped. The second is still valid as we haven't mirrored it yet | 17:26 |
clarkb | (and we recently had disk space issues with openafs so not sure we'll mirror that immediately) | 17:26 |
opendevreview | Clark Boylan proposed opendev/zuul-providers master: Build actual trixie now that it is released https://review.opendev.org/c/opendev/zuul-providers/+/958561 | 17:26 |
clarkb | that should make the TODOs more accurate | 17:26 |
frickler | clarkb: iiuc we need mirrors in place for that to work | 17:32 |
frickler | or fix dib to have an option to work without mirrors | 17:32 |
clarkb | frickler: how did testing work then? | 17:32 |
frickler | special case for the "testing" name in dib | 17:33 |
clarkb | huh | 17:33 |
frickler | actually it is not mirrors, but some repo still missing: 2025-08-26 17:30:19.624 | W: The repository 'http://security.debian.org trixie/updates Release' does not have a Release file. | 17:33 |
frickler | I can look up the code after the TC meeting | 17:33 |
clarkb | oh! dib assumes that there will be a security repo for each release. But debian must not create one until they need to publish security fixes | 17:34 |
clarkb | I'm not sure what the solution to that is, but I suspect ^ is the cause | 17:34 |
clarkb | and testing being testing doesn't have security repos ever I'm guessing? | 17:34 |
frickler | clarkb: something like that, it also excludes any -updates repos iirc | 17:37 |
frickler | actually I think this is yet another case here. looks like we should switch the default around so this doesn't repeat each release https://opendev.org/openstack/diskimage-builder/src/branch/master/diskimage_builder/elements/debian-minimal/environment.d/10-debian-minimal.bash#L20-L29 | 17:42 |
frickler | or maybe the "*" case is no longer needed at all by now? | 17:42 |
clarkb | ++ | 17:43 |
clarkb | frickler fwiw I'm working on fixing up the dib ci jobs right now (centos 9 stream fixed their images) | 17:43 |
clarkb | but hopefully we can get that in a working state then we'll be able to fix the debian-minimal element | 17:44 |
frickler | cool, feel free to ping me when you need reviews | 17:44 |
corvus | clarkb: re your earlier question, i expect promote to work. we run all the promote jobs and use a dispatch job so everything still works even if only jobs defs are changed. | 17:49 |
opendevreview | Clark Boylan proposed openstack/diskimage-builder master: Drop Ubuntu Bionic and Older testing https://review.opendev.org/c/openstack/diskimage-builder/+/957985 | 17:49 |
clarkb | corvus: ++ to the dispatch job thanks | 17:50 |
opendevreview | Clark Boylan proposed openstack/diskimage-builder master: Drop Ubuntu Bionic and Older testing https://review.opendev.org/c/openstack/diskimage-builder/+/957985 | 18:01 |
opendevreview | Clark Boylan proposed opendev/infra-manual master: Drop the suggestion for using the x/ namespace https://review.opendev.org/c/opendev/infra-manual/+/958571 | 18:37 |
opendevreview | Clark Boylan proposed openstack/diskimage-builder master: Drop unnecessary debian security location configuration switch https://review.opendev.org/c/openstack/diskimage-builder/+/958572 | 18:42 |
clarkb | frickler: ^ something like that maybe? | 18:42 |
opendevreview | Clark Boylan proposed opendev/zuul-providers master: Build actual trixie now that it is released https://review.opendev.org/c/opendev/zuul-providers/+/958561 | 18:43 |
clarkb | I added a depends on to the zuul-providers change so that we can see if this makes the whole chain happy | 18:43 |
corvus | clarkb: i see nothing about debian in the zuul-announce queue | 19:24 |
clarkb | ack | 19:25 |
fungi | yeah, sorry, didn't get to it just yet | 19:26 |
opendevreview | Clark Boylan proposed opendev/system-config master: Build trixie python base container images https://review.opendev.org/c/opendev/system-config/+/958480 | 20:57 |
clarkb | ok thats the first bit of moving the trixie image add atop the quay move | 20:58 |
clarkb | I've got to do a school run, but when I get back I'll start on the other related changes to move things to consume base images from quay.io | 21:00 |
opendevreview | Merged openstack/diskimage-builder master: Drop Ubuntu Bionic and Older testing https://review.opendev.org/c/openstack/diskimage-builder/+/957985 | 21:34 |
opendevreview | Clark Boylan proposed opendev/system-config master: Pull hound's base python image from quay https://review.opendev.org/c/opendev/system-config/+/958593 | 22:09 |
opendevreview | Clark Boylan proposed opendev/system-config master: Pull python base image for statsd metric reporters from quay.io https://review.opendev.org/c/opendev/system-config/+/958594 | 22:12 |
opendevreview | Clark Boylan proposed opendev/system-config master: Build ircbots with base python image from quay.io https://review.opendev.org/c/opendev/system-config/+/958596 | 22:15 |
opendevreview | Clark Boylan proposed opendev/system-config master: Build gerrit image with python base from quay.io https://review.opendev.org/c/opendev/system-config/+/958597 | 22:17 |
opendevreview | Clark Boylan proposed opendev/system-config master: Pull jinja-init base python image from quay https://review.opendev.org/c/opendev/system-config/+/958598 | 22:20 |
opendevreview | Clark Boylan proposed opendev/gerritbot master: Pull python base images from quay.io https://review.opendev.org/c/opendev/gerritbot/+/958600 | 22:21 |
opendevreview | Clark Boylan proposed opendev/grafyaml master: Pull python base images from quay.io https://review.opendev.org/c/opendev/grafyaml/+/958601 | 22:23 |
opendevreview | Clark Boylan proposed opendev/lodgeit master: Pull base images from opendevorg rather than opendevmirror https://review.opendev.org/c/opendev/lodgeit/+/958602 | 22:26 |
opendevreview | Clark Boylan proposed opendev/statusbot master: Pull python base images from quay.io https://review.opendev.org/c/opendev/statusbot/+/958603 | 22:27 |
clarkb | ok I think that is the bulk of the images on the opendev side of things. | 22:27 |
clarkb | let me go and add a consistent hashtag | 22:27 |
clarkb | https://review.opendev.org/q/hashtag:%22opendev-on-quay%22+(status:open%20OR%20status:merged) | 22:30 |
clarkb | hrm it looks liek these changes are not finding the images built by the parent in the insecure ci registry | 22:32 |
clarkb | that change last verified on August 13. I thought we set the insecure ci registry to prune after a month but amybe I need to recheck the parent to refresh the insecure ci registry? I'll try that | 22:32 |
opendevreview | Clark Boylan proposed zuul/zuul-jobs master: Default configure_mirrors_extra_repos to False in configure-mirrors https://review.opendev.org/c/zuul/zuul-jobs/+/958605 | 22:46 |
clarkb | looks like rerunning builds for the parent has gotten things happier in the child changes. | 23:35 |
corvus | clarkb: expiration: 15552000 # 180 days | 23:40 |
clarkb | huh I wonder what happened then | 23:52 |
clarkb | there were definite 404s on the first pass of the hound change and those went away after I rechecked the parent and let it build images then rechecked hound again | 23:52 |
Generated by irclog2html.py 4.0.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!